Description

Originally constructed circa 1904 and having been substantially extended and comprehensively modernised throughout to a high specification offering flexible internal accommodation. This large family home occupies a superb position on arguably one of the most sought after residential roads in the area with delightful countryside views to the rear. The accommodation comprises entrance hallway, downstairs WC, elegant lounge, playroom/sitting room, refitted study by Lewis & Hill, magnificent open-plan living/dining kitchen by Dale Penney Kitchens, integrated pantry/bar and utility room. On the first floor are four double bedrooms, bedroom one with Juliette balcony, contemporary freestanding roll top bath with floor mounted waterfall mixer tap and access to en-suite wet room, dressing room/bedroom five, luxury fitted family bathroom with four piece suite. Outside to the front is a large in-out driveway, single garage and a magnificent rear gardens with separate outside kitchen with covered area and a studio cabin/gym.

Location

Rothley is a particularly well serviced Charnwood Forest village situated around a traditional village green and offering extensive local facilities including popular pubs, restaurants, shops and school. The village is particularly well placed for fast access to Loughborough and Leicester and the M1 at Markfield. Local facilities also include Rothley Park Golf Club, Rothley Court Hotel / Restaurant, Soar Valley Leisure Centre and local beauty spots include Swithland Reservoir and Bradgate Park.
